doubly-linked-list

    1

    2답변

    노드의 제목 요소와 관련하여 이중 연결 목록에 노드를 사전 순으로 추가하려고합니다. 지금까지 목록을 반복하여 시도하고 사례 (strcmp(title, currTitle) > 0)을 확인했습니다. 그러나 아래에 나열된 시도가 연결된 목록에 항목을 추가하지 않으므로 반복이 작동하지 않습니다 (이유는 확실하지 않습니다). if-else 블록에 대한 4 가지 조건

    -1

    1답변

    저는 현재 데이터 구조와 알고리즘을 배우고 있으며 연습 중 하나는 처음부터 DoublyLinkedList를 구현하는 것입니다. 불행히도 "listDelete" 작업을 내 목록에서 수행하려고하면 내 코드가 일부 정수 값에는 적합하지만 일부 값에는 적합하지 않습니다. 23, 45, 100, 5, 15을 삭제하려고하면 문제가 없습니다. 목록에서 을 삭제하려고하면

    2

    1답변

    현재이 내 PrintNode() 메소드와 나에게 거래 없음주고있다 : 날짜 ///////////////////// 설명 // ///// DebitCredit ///// 금액 12345678 : 2012년 1월 15일는 100 복근 그리고 내가 값이 올바른 장소에 넣어 싶습니다. 12345678는 Trasaction 없음 아래에 있어야한다 : 2012/01/

    1

    1답변

    새로운 기능 c.I 이중 연결 목록을 만드는 다음 코드를 작성하십시오. #include <stdio.h> #include <stdlib.h> #include <string.h> #include <conio.h> typedef struct Dnode { char c; struct Dnode *left; struct Dnod

    0

    2답변

    이중 연결 목록을 사용하여 갑판에있는 52 개의 카드를 모두 나타내는 프로그램을 만들려고합니다. 어떻게해야합니까? 클래스와 메소드를 작성해야하며 기존 Java 클래스를 사용할 수 없습니다. 여기 여기 public class DoublyLinkedList<T> { private Node<T> head; private Node<T> rear;

    1

    1답변

    출력을 즉 노드의 결과가 둘 이상인 노드를 검색하려고합니다. 그래서 나는 새로운 이중 연결리스트를 만들고 그것에 새로운 노드를 추가하려고합니다. 그러나 단지 1 개의 정확한 결과를 얻습니다. 두 번째는 주소 또는 노드를 추측하거나 에러입니다. 이미지에 표시된대로. 내 코드 : Order::Node* Order::searchByDate(string date)

    -2

    1답변

    편집 : 그래, 원래의 모든 문제/질문을 수정하고 완료했습니다. 그러나 이제는 List.cpp에서 54 개의 gotoLast에 세분화 오류가 발생하고 왜 segfaulting인지 알 수 없습니다. List.h : #ifndef _list_h #define _list_h struct ListNode { int data; int rank; List

    1

    1답변

    사용자로부터 입력 문자열을 가져온 다음 문자열의 문자를 사용하여 이중 연결된 목록을 채워야하는 할당이 있습니다. 즉, 사용자 문자열을 반복하고 이중 연결 목록을 생성해야합니다. for 루프를 만들었고 출력이 작동하지만 출력을 표시 한 직후 프로그램이 중단됩니다. 나는 C++에서 총 2 주간의 경험을 가지고 있으므로 신기한 실수를 용서해주십시오. 아래 코드를

    0

    3답변

    이 int -> 6-> 8-> 10으로 이중 연결된 목록이 있고 int 1-> 7-> 3으로 다른 이중 연결된 목록을 만듭니다. 내가하고 싶은 일은 첫 번째 목록의 int 5를 두 번째 목록의 int 1과 연결하는 것입니다. 다른 한 목록의 첫 번째 노드를 다른 목록의 첫 번째 노드를 가리 키도록합니다. 여기에 모든 의 거친 그림 나는 가능하면 그렇게하는

    1

    2답변

    이 코드 부분에 문제가 있습니다. 내 목표는 이중 연결된 목록을 뒤집는 것입니다. 반전 된 목록을 인쇄하려고하면 쓰레기 값이 표시됩니다. typedef struct node{ int val; struct node* prev; struct node* next; }Node; typedef struct list{ Node